When have Long Range Scanners "on" on the map, I find ti hard to determine territory boundaries, due to the white / greyscale washing out the color on my domain. I find myself having to turn it off to see what is and is not mine. Is there a way to make territory colors more bold and less pastel? It may only need to be that way when long range scanners is on. Currently, It looks like I screwed up the gamma settings.
